iShares MSCI Taiwan ETF

214 hedge funds and large institutions have $2.5B invested in iShares MSCI Taiwan ETF in 2023 Q2 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 35 funds opening new positions, 56 increasing their positions, 65 reducing their positions, and 28 closing their positions.
